Rebecca Taylor Launches Video Series

by Sydney Sadick

Rebecca Taylor is giving us a glimpse into her inspiration and the origin of her print- and texture-infused brand via a new video series dubbed “Rebecca Taylor Shorts.” The series features four chapters: Rebecca’s Story, About Lace, Mum Knows Best, and Art of the Print with images that capture the designer’s insights to her life, influential moments, and elements of her collection. The first three videos are lensed handheld on an Alexa mini by director Sam Shannon and produced by IDOL NY. Each film also incorporates playful animations created by illustrator Amanda Sandlin. The first film shows Rebecca’s journey, from growing up in a small village in New Zealand to moving to NYC. The three subsequent chapters will introduce Taylor’s relationship to lace (one of her signatures) and why it’s been a part of her DNA since launching her brand. She also offers a look at her mom’s influence on her design aesthetic and love affair with crafting intricate prints that are also at the core of the brand.

“I wanted to create this series to connect with my customer more closely and give her insight to my story and the inception of the brand DNA,” Taylor said in a statement. “With all the social media platforms at our finger tips we can share our brand message directly with our customer in a way that is innovative, creative, and genuine.”

The videos are available on RebeccaTaylor.com as well as her social media channels.
